  1. MINOR PIECES - the interplay between Bishops and Knights (trying to make one superior to the other)
  2. PAWN STRUCTURE - a broad subject that encompasses doubled pawns, isolated pawns, backward pawns, passed pawns, etc
  3. SPACE - the annexation of territory on a chess board
  4. MATERIAL - owning pieces of greater value than the opponent's
  5. FILES AND SQUARES - files, ranks, and diagonals act as pathways for your pieces, while squares act as homes. Whole plans can center around the domination of a file, or the creation of a weak square in the enemy camp
  6. DEVELOPMENT - a lead in development gives you more force in a specific area of the board. This is a temporary imbalance because the opponent will eventually catch up.
  7. INITIATIVE - dictating the tempo of a game. This is also a temporary imbalance.
